System Specifications
Key parameters across Filabot systems, side by side.
| Specification | EX3 Bundle | EX6 Extruder Setup | EX6 Industrial Setup | Full Recycling Setup |
|---|---|---|---|---|
| Best for | Education, makerspaces, and complete entry-level filament production workflows | Polymer R&D + prototyping | High-volume + abrasive / filled polymers | Closed-loop plastic recycling |
| Primary workflow | Filament making | Filament production + material development | Industrial extrusion + advanced materials | Reclaim, pelletize, extrude, cool, and spool |
| Inline measurement | Available by setup | Filameasure + Filalogger | Filameasure + Filalogger | Available by setup |
| Recycling components | Optional | Optional | Optional | Reclaimer + Pelletizer included |
| Warranty | 1 year | 3 years | 3 years | 3 years |

Compatible Materials
The EX6 platform processes a wide range of thermoplastic polymers, from commodity resins to high-performance engineering materials.
ABS, HIPS, and PS require proper ventilation and fume filtration.
